  description: "Service Enabling Payments against Operator Carrier Billing Systems\n\n# Introduction\n\nThe Carrier Billing API provides programmable interface for developers and other users (capabilities consumers) to charge an amount on a mobile line.\nIt can be easily integrated and allows end-users to buy digital content in an easy & secured way. The API provides management of a payment entity and its associated lifecycle.\n\n# Relevant terms and definitions\n\n- **Carrier Billing**:\nAn online payment process which allows users to make purchases by charging payments against Telco Operator Billing Systems, accordingly to the user's configuration in the Telco Operator. In a common usage in the industry, the payment is processed on current account balance or charged on next bill generated for this line.\n\n- **Payment**:\nThe process of paying for a (set of) good(s)/service(s).\n\n- **1-STEP Payment**:\nPayment process performed in one phase (i.e. one action), that involves all the Telco Operator Carrier Billing Systems checking and trigger the charging request against Billing Systems.\n\n- **2-STEP Payment**:\nPayment process performed in two phases (i.e. two actions). First action deals with payment preparation request to guarantee the reservation of the involved amount. Second action is an explicit confirmation or cancellation of the payment by the user. Any payment not confirmed/cancelled by a given user is discarded after some time in order to avoid inconsistency in the billing systems.\n\n# API Functionality\n\nThis API allows to third party clients to request the payment of a (set of) digital good(s)/service(s), as well as to retrieve information about a specific payment or a list of payments.\n\nIn the scope of **version v0.5rc1, only one-off payments are covered**. Recurrent payments (a.k.a. payment subscriptions) are not covered so far.\n\nThe API provides several endpoints/operations:\n- An endpoint to request a 1-STEP Payment, named `createPayment`.\n- A set of endpoints to request a 2-STEP Payment:\n  - One endpoint to setup the payment reservation, named `preparePayment`.\n  - A couple of endpoints to confirm/cancel such payment reservation, named `confirmPayment` and `cancelPayment` respectively.\n- A set of endpoints to retrieve information about a list of payments or a specific payment (identified by its specific `paymentId`), named `retrievePayments` and `retrievePayment` respectively.\n- A callback endpoint where API Server can send notifications about a payment procedure, as defined within `createPayment` and `preparePayment` operations, towards the `sink` when provided by API client.\n\nThe usage of the API is based on Payment resource, which can be created (in 1-STEP or 2-STEP Payment process), confirmed/cancelled (for 2-STEP Payment process), and queried/retrieved (list of payments or a specific payment).\n\nBefore starting to use the API, the developer needs to know about the below specified details:\n- **Payment service endpoint**: The URL pointing to the RESTful resource of the payment API. As 1-STEP and 2-STEP processes are managed, 2 separate tags _`One Step Payment`_ and _`Two Step Payment`_ have been defined to explicitly distinguish them in the API specification. A third tag _`Payment`_ is defined for common operations in both processes (query/retrieve list of payments or a specific payment).\n- **1-STEP & 2-STEP Payment**:\n  - **1-STEP Payment**: The request intent is to charge an amount to the mobile line. When the server receives the request, it will check the user account associated with this line and, if nothing prevents it, the amount is charged and will be either bill in next invoice or removed from current line credit/balance.\n  - **2-STEP Payment**: The first call is to request a payment preparation, which implies an amount reservation. The amount is not charged and the server has to be ready to get a confirmation or a cancellation to perform the payment. Only when the confirmation is done, payment is charged. Depending on business rules of the Telco operator, a `prepared` payment could expire after a defined delay.\n- **Notification URL**: Developers may provide a callback URL (`sink` param) on which status change notifications, regarding the payment, can be received from the Telco Operator. This is an optional parameter.\n\nFollowing diagram shows the API resources operation sequencing:\n![PaymentSequence](https://raw.githubusercontent.com/camaraproject/CarrierBillingCheckOut/r3.2/documentation/API_documentation/resources/Carrier_Billing_sequence_diagram.png)\n\nFollow picture provides information about the payment state engine (state description & transition):\n![Payment State Engine](https://raw.githubusercontent.com/camaraproject/CarrierBillingCheckOut/r3.2/documentation/API_documentation/resources/Carrier_Billing_State_Engine.JPG)\n\nState transitions:\n\n**1-STEP Payment**\n\nIf `createPayment` is a **SYNC** process:\n- Response contains `paymentId` and paymentStatus=`succeeded`.\n- In case of any error scenario `paymentId` is not created.\n\nIf `createPayment` is an **ASYNC** process:\n- Response contains `paymentId` and paymentStatus=`processing`. After completion:\n  - When payment is successfully completed then paymentStatus=`succeeded`.\n  - When payment is not successfully performed then paymentStatus=`denied`.\n- In case of any error scenario `paymentId` is not created.\n\n**2-STEP Payment**\n\nFIRST STEP\n\nIf `preparePayment` is a **SYNC** process:\n- **Case A** - `validationInfo` is NOT provided in response.\n  - Response contains `paymentId` and paymentStatus=`reserved`.\n- **Case B** - `validationInfo` is provided in response.\n  - Response contains `paymentId` and paymentStatus=`pending_validation`.\n- In case of any error scenario `paymentId` is not created.\n\nIf `preparePayment` is an **ASYNC** process:\n- **Case A** - `validationInfo` is NOT provided in response.\n  - Response contains `paymentId` and paymentStatus=`processing`. After completion:\n    - When payment preparation is successfully completed then paymentStatus=`reserved`.\n    - When payment preparation is not successfully performed then paymentStatus=`denied`.\n- **Case B** - `validationInfo` is provided in response.\n  - Response contains `paymentId` and paymentStatus=`processing`. After completion:\n    - When payment preparation is successfully completed then paymentStatus=`pending_validation`. [1]\n    - When payment preparation is not successfully performed then paymentStatus=`denied`.\n- In case of any error scenario `paymentId` is not created.\n\n[OPTIONAL] VALIDATE STEP [1]\n\nAfter `validatePayment`, paymentStatus=`reserved` OR `denied`, depending whether it was successful or not.\n\nSECOND STEP\n\nAfter `confirmPayment`, paymentStatus=`succeeded` OR `denied`, depending whether it was successful or not.\n\nAfter `cancelPayment`, paymentStatus=`cancelled`.\n\n# Generic Clarification about optional parameters\n\nRegarding optional parameters, they can be conditionally mandatory for a Telco Operator to implement them based on business scenarios or applicable regulations in a given market.\n\nNOTE: Within a given market, in a multi Telco Operator ecosystem, the set of optional parameters to be implemented MUST be aligned among involved Telco Operators.\n\n# Authorization and authentication\n\nThe \"Camara Security and Interoperability Profile\" provides details of how an API consumer requests an access token. Please refer to Identity and Consent Management (https://github.com/camaraproject/IdentityAndConsentManagement/) for the released version of the profile.\n\nThe specific authorization flows to be used will be agreed upon during the onboarding process, happening between the API consumer and the API provider, taking into account the declared purpose for accessing the API, whilst also being subject to the prevailing legal framework dictated by local legislation.\n\nIn cases where personal data is processed by the API and users can exercise their rights through mechanisms such as opt-in and/or opt-out, the use of three-legged access tokens is mandatory. This ensures that the API remains in compliance with privacy regulations, upholding the principles of transparency and user-centric privacy-by-design.\n\n# Identifying the phone number from the access token\n\nThis API requires the API consumer to identify a phone number as the subject of the API as follows:\n- When the API is invoked using a two-legged access token, the subject will be identified from the optional `phoneNumber` field, which therefore MUST be provided.\n- When a three-legged access token is used however, this optional identifier MUST NOT be provided, as the subject will be uniquely identified from the access token.\n\nThis approach simplifies API usage for API consumers using a three-legged access token to invoke the API by relying on the information that is associated with the access token and was identified during the authentication process.\n\n## Error handling:\n\n- If the subject cannot be identified from the access token and the optional `phoneNumber` field is not included in the request, then the server will return an error with the `422 MISSING_IDENTIFIER` error code.\n\n- If the subject can be identified from the access token and the optional `phoneNumber` field is also included in the request, then the server will return an error with the `422 UNNECESSARY_IDENTIFIER` error code. This will be the case even if the same phone number is identified by these two methods, as the server is unable to make this comparison.\n\n# Additional CAMARA error responses\n\nThe list of error codes in this API specification is not exhaustive. Therefore the API specification may not document some non-mandatory error statuses as indicated in `CAMARA API Design Guide`.\n\nPlease refer to the `CAMARA_common.yaml` of the Commonalities Release associated to this API version for a complete list of error responses. The applicable Commonalities Release can be identified in the `API Readiness Checklist` document associated to this API version.\n\nAs a specific rule, error `501 - NOT_IMPLEMENTED` can be only a possible error response if it is explicitly documented in the API.\n\n# Further info and support\n\n(FAQs will be added in a later version of the documentation)"
